Shane Watson And Ajit Agarkar Drift Away From Delhi Capitals After IPL 2023, Here Is The Surprising Reason

A disappointing news is coming from the Delhi Capitals camp after the conclusion of 16th edition of Indian Premier League. The former Indian bowler Ajit Agarkar and the Australian veteran all-rounder who were the part of the coaching staff in DC have separated themselves from the franchisees.

The reason behind their separation is coming as both these players have got some coaching offers from anywhere else. Also, in this season the performance of DC has not been upto the mark and the failed in all the three departments.

The Capitals made an official announcement on their Twitter account regarding this development. They expressed gratitude towards Ajit Agarkar and Shane Watson for their valuable contributions and acknowledged that the franchise will always consider them part of their family.

The official Twitter handle of Delhi Capitals reads as – “You’ll always have a place to call home here 💙 Thank You, Ajit and Watto, for your contributions. All the very best for your future endeavours 🙌.”

Ajit Agarkar has an impressive international cricket record with 191 ODIs, 26 Tests, and four T20Is for India. According to reports, he is currently the leading candidate for the position of chairman of selectors for the Indian men’s team. This post has been vacant since Chetan Sharma resigned in February.

On the other hand, Shane Watson has recently hammered his first role as a head coach. He has been appointed by the San Francisco Unicorns, a franchise in Major League Cricket, to lead the coaching staff for the inaugural edition of the six-team tournament which will start on July 13th.
